Experimental study and theoretical analysis on flame characteristic of blast burner combustion with oxygen-enriched
Using blast burner on the study of the LPG oxygen-enriched combustion,and composed the experimental platform with flame burning test device and oxygen-enriched supplying system.By this platform,through experiment,the temperature region,flame length,angle etc,changed as below when oxygen concentration was between 21% to 30%.The length shortened 16.7%,the angle of flame entrance increased,flame temperature gradient increased,the highest flame temperature improved by 24.8%,flame intensity increased.Analyzing by combustion theory,burning speed increased linearly with the increasing of oxygen concentration,and the combustion region decreased.Theoretical analysis and the experimental result were uniform.
